Interventions for Adolescent Obesity
The Role of Activity Tracking on Weight Loss in Obese Adolescents
Sponsor: The University of Texas Medical Branch, Galveston
A NA clinical study on Adolescent Obesity, this trial is completed. The trial is conducted by The University of Texas Medical Branch, Galveston and has accumulated 8 data snapshots since 2018.
